Northchase and Ogden are places in North Carolina.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Ogden has the higher population (8,363 vs 5,879 in Northchase). Ogden has the higher median household income ($111,461 vs $56,659 in Northchase). Ogden has the higher median home value ($431,000 vs $286,700 in Northchase).
